A Life Dedicated to Rugby

Scott Hastings' rugby journey began in 1986, and over the next 11 years, he became an integral part of Scotland's rugby history. With 65 caps and an incredible 51 matches alongside his brother Gavin, they formed a dynamic duo that inspired a nation. Their last Grand Slam victory in 1990 is a testament to their skill and determination.

Lions Pride

Hastings' talent wasn't confined to Scotland; he was also a proud member of the British & Irish Lions, participating in tours to Australia and New Zealand. His leadership and single-minded focus on victory are legendary. Former coach Ian McGeechan recalls Hastings as an essential part of the team's success, a true leader on and off the field.

Beyond the Game

Hastings' impact extended beyond his playing days. After retiring in 1999, he embarked on a successful broadcasting career, sharing his expertise and passion with rugby fans worldwide. His contributions to the sport's growth and popularity are undeniable.

A Personal Loss

The news of Hastings' passing due to complications from cancer treatment has saddened the rugby community. His family's statement reflects the depth of their grief, especially as it coincides with the birthday of his late wife, Jenny. The outpouring of tributes from fellow players, coaches, and fans highlights the profound impact he had on those around him.

A Lasting Legacy

Scott Hastings' legacy is one of passion, confidence, and aggression, as described by Scotland coach Gregor Townsend. His ability to elevate those around him, as noted by Ian McGeechan, is a testament to his character. Brian Moore's tribute captures the essence of Hastings' playing style—always giving his best, never letting his teammates down.
